Simple question (I think). Is it possible to pattern a feature that has a "replaced" face in it?

I have a hex protrusion on a flat surface, the top of the hex is curved using sketches and the replace face tool. I would then like to pattern this hex and corresponding face in a circular pattern.

I am able to pattern the simple hex protrusion, but not the curved face.

Any suggestions?

Thanks in advance

Tim
 
Hi,

I think it doesn't work if the surface doesn't extend naturally to cover the other hexes.

You can either pattern the faces and use boolean/unite to create add the material inside the patterned surfaces (one by one - the surface will hide each time you do a boolean)

Your other option is to pattern the solid hexes w/o the replace face. Then pattern the curved surface. And repeat the replace face for each occurence of the pattern.

Hi,

If all you little blocks are in contact with each other, here is what you should do:
- create one top surface
- pattern that surface
- create the outside contour with an extruded surface
- stitch all those surfaces
- boolean/unite to create the solid

If they don't touch, try buiding the initial solid differently if possible. Otherwise, one by one is the only choice I see...

Hi,

Yes, you are right. As soon as I opened the Parasolid version I found I could pattern it as a single item.

When trying to pattern the original feature, with the cutout, it uses the cutout operation from one entity and projects it onto the pattern occurrence next to it.

By using the Parasolid it sees it as a single item that can be patterned.

Is it possible to "cut and paste" this solid item into an existing part?

Thanks for the help.

-Tim
 
Tim,

Insert Part Copy (IPC) will work when saved as .par. But it
will be placed at the original coordinates that is 0,0,0

BTW: doing a circular pattern with an hex won't work because
the shape ist fixed. To pattern the hex to look like the
lens you must pattern along the x and y axes. Have a look
at the file below the image contains the pattern data
